Desde Europa, una boricua nos lee eso que llaman conflicto de género...

from Temprano en la Tarde... EL PODCAST

Ashley Méndez Ruiz, maestra en Estudios de Género • Hablaríamos de tú experiencias como estudiante graduada en USA y España, específicamente de cómo son en Europa (España) los estudios de género. • ¿Qué referencias tiene los jóvenes españoles "lo político"? o La derecha de VOX o Cómo tú ves desde afuera (y adentro) la situación de la violencia contra la mujer y las estrategias para manejarla. o Rol de la iglesia El Bo. Montes Llanos busca nuevas formas de mirarse y construirse • Dr. Mara Pastor nos habla de los procesos organizacionales • Descentralizar las asambleas de pueblo con células en los barrios • Transformación de los referentes políticos
